Tap @ O’Brien’s. I was warned before I tried it that people either love this beer or hate it. Unfortunately, I fell into the latter. Pours clear gold with a big bubbly white head. Flat aroma of grain and flowery hops. Toasty malt, biscuits, and metal dominate the taste, with grassy and faintly citrus hops bringing up the rear. There’s just not enough hops in it for me. Its almost like a Czech pilsner.

On tap at Stone’s World Bistro early 01/08. Pours clear gold with lasting thin head of white foam and sheet lacing. The aroma is sweet sugary malts and floral to spice hoppiness. Taste begins with both sweet malts and floral to pine hops. The hop bitterness grows as the taste moves forward really showing a combination of bittering notes like floral, spice and pine hops as well as some grapefruit hops near the finish.

Tasting this inspired a comical discussion with the brewer over the facination that people have with Double IPAs (a style I’m fond of). He mentioned that it took courage to brew a quality IPA and not just make a malty beer with an overwhelmingly large quantity of hops added. I think after trying this that I agree. This is very well balanced, it has a sweet smoothness, but is also very dry and bitter on the finish. A big fresh pine needle scent with lots of flowery citrus notes. Its an orange color with a nice frothy white head.

On tap at Lucky Baldwin’s. Hazy golden amber with a creamy white head. Great grapefruit, honey, fruit, and pine aroma. Creamy palate. Honey sweet with earthy citrus and pine taste transitioning to an orange flavor and finishing with a hoppy perfume taste in the back of the mouth. Excellent beer.
